Review of New England Central Palmer to Brattleboro Cab Ride DVD

Climb aboard the cab of a New England Central GP-38 diesel engine for a "Head-End" ride through the picturesque New England countryside from Palmer, MA to Brattleboro, VT. We begin at Palmer and continue north on the former Central Vermont Railroad through Barretts, Belchertown, Amherst, Millers Falls and Northfield before arriving at Brattleboro. This program was in March, 1997. Narration is provided referring to locations and other points of interest. 60 Minutes - Color - Sound
